  • Terrible company and customer service. I bought a pair of shoes in the sale which were too big so I planned to exchange them. It stated on the invoice I had 28 days to do this. When I tried to do the exchange, it wouldn’t let me and then I saw on the website that I had to start the exchange 14 days after purchase. This was only a couple of days after so I’d hoped they would honour my exchange as I’d be paying extra for the new pair. I contacted customer service who said they wouldn’t do that and their policy was on the website. This is completely misleading as it clearly says on the invoice 28 days. I’m astonished that this company was happy lose a returning customer and seems not to care about its reputation. Terrible way to treat customers
